Have you looked on your motherboard web site for new win 7 drivers? Win 7 doesn't have USB 3 drivers built in so you have to install them from the web site for motherboard or if PC is a brand name, from the web site for the device.
using them might be fun, one way to get them onto PC while USB doesn't work is use a DVD drive if you have one, or put hdd into another PC and download the drivers and place them on the hdd. then install hdd in new PC again and run the driver installers.
